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96361051534 6702684 7707272 18461399
16596315540 734943
16596315540 734943
05638495 019952020 52431
All about undefined
Interested in learning more?
16596315540 734943
05638495 019952020 52431
See more
63835995 971 17816530997
670205091 3074 707268
See more
821667534 28881694
246 464719 03651
See more